Arnold, Michael James was born on January 8, 1946 in Guatemala City, Guatemala. Son of James Elliott and Roberta Elaine Arnold.
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ering, University Idaho, 1969. Master of Science in Aeronautical Engineering with distinction, Naval Postgraduate School, 1978.
Commissioned ensign, United States Navy, 1969; advanced through grades to commander, United States Navy, 1984; helicopter flight training, Pensacola, Florida, 1969-1970; pilot search and rescue, Kingsville, Texas, 1970-1972; pilot antisubmarine warfare (High School-4), San Diego, 1972-1976; with, United States Ship Tarawa, San Diego, 1979-1981; with, Antisubmarine Warefare Wing Pacific Fleet, San Diego, 1981-1984; with, Naval Air Systems Command, Washington, 1984-1988; deputy director, Cruise Missiles Progressive Western Region, San Diego, 1988-1991; director, Cruise Missiles Progressive Western Region, San Diego, 1991-1992; retired, 1992.
Member Association Old Crows, Navy Helicopter Association, Apple Programmers and Developers Association (independent), Sigma Xi (associate).
Married Michelle Lee Connelly, February 1, 1969. Children: Reenie Lee, Tige, Donovan.
